Output 25a8118e53dbb7f16d0e290cb916e23a0b5f1e57d891ed9df887d5ea5ee7ceac:0

value
11752728
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 033f0c63cca00b4a89b1e4cae526106708deb777 OP_EQUALVERIFY OP_CHECKSIG
address
1JAZFniiPHjR7YturgH8zCsnSzc2oA9MU
transaction
25a8118e53dbb7f16d0e290cb916e23a0b5f1e57d891ed9df887d5ea5ee7ceac
spent
true